About 2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ide
2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ide (PubChem CID 141369274) has the molecular formula C13H16F2N2O4
and a molecular weight of 302.28 g/mol. Its IUPAC name is 2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ide.

What is the SMILES notation for 2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ide?
The canonical SMILES for 2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ide is CC(CO)(CO)C(=O)NCc1ccc(C(N)=O)c(F)c1F.
What is the InChIKey of 2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ide?
The InChIKey is NVYKLTYXFRUCFC-UHFFFAOYSA-N. The full InChI is InChI=1S/C13H16F2N2O4/c1-13(5-18,6-19)12(21)17-4-7-2-3-8(11(16)20)10(15)9(7)14/h2-3,18-19H,4-6H2,1H3,(H2,16,20)(H,17,21).
What are the key properties of 2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ide?
2,3-difluoro-4-[[[3-hydroxy-2-(hydroxymethyl)-2-methylpropanoyl]amino]methyl]benzamide has a molecular weight of 302.28 g/mol, XLogP of -0.33, 6 rotatable bonds, 4 hydrogen bond donors, and 4 hydrogen bond acceptors.
